Steam Early Access survival gameRustis no stranger to controversy — having madeplayers’ in-game penis size based on their Steam ID— and it looks like there is about to be another one.

In the latest update,Rusthas made gender assignment tied to your Steam ID, meaning players have no choice in the matter of whether they are male or female. Some vocal players are upset by this change, but everything about the player’s character has always been randomly generated, perhaps to simulate being born into the real world.

Article image

Developer Garry Newman hadpreviously said, “We’re not ‘taking the choice away’ from you. You never had a choice. A man’s voice coming out of a woman’s body is no more weird than an 8-year-old boy’s voice coming out of a man’s body.”

This update released besides a plethora of other changes which you cancheck out on the developer’s blog.
